Transaction

a44d11368476ad9aa78e5b84cad4e973afdbb8eecf740f2bcd2d2cee0e16ea99
295,227 confirmations
Timestamp
1594340712
Block638,533
Fee681 sats
Fee rate3.05 sats/vB
view on mempool.space

Inputs & Outputs